Rotherham United 0 Hereford 0: Scott debut ends in Millers draw

A Don Valley Stadium debut for new Rotherham manager Andy Scott ended in frustration as the Millers failed to close the gap on the League Two play-offs.

Scott was without defender Johnny Mullins (knee) for his first match in charge. Goalkeeper Andy Warrington was out with a foot injury so Jamie Annerson continued between the posts.

Tom Pope and Ryan Taylor both went close, before Ryan Cresswell saw a header cleared off the line as the home side pushed for an opener.

The Bulls also went close to taking the lead when Joe Colbeck fired a shot against the upright.

However neither side were able to find a winner at the Don Valley Stadium and had to settle for a point each.
